A: The choice depends on your fabric type and desired workflow. Hot peel films are typically removed immediately after pressing while still hot, suitable for many polyester blends. Cold peel films are removed after cooling, often providing better stretchability and a softer hand feel on textiles like 100% cotton or performance wear. We can advise on the best option for your substrate.
